Preparing Your openSUSE System for Skype

Before installing Skype, ensure your system is up-to-date and ready for new software. Follow these steps to prepare your openSUSE:
  1. **Update Your System**: Open the terminal and execute:
```bash sudo zypper refresh sudo zypper update ```
  1. **Install Required Dependencies**: Skype might need certain libraries to run smoothly. Install them using:
```bash sudo zypper install libXv1 libXss1 alsa-plugins-pulse ```

Step-by-Step Guide to Install Skype on openSUSE

Using the Official RPM Package

The most straightforward method to install Skype on openSUSE is by using the RPM package provided by Microsoft:
  1. **Download the RPM Package**: Visit the [Skype official website](https://www.skype.com) and download the latest RPM package for Linux.
  1. **Install the Package**: Navigate to the directory where the package is downloaded and run:
```bash sudo zypper install skypeforlinux-64.rpm ```
  1. **Verify Installation**: Once installed, you can check if Skype is accessible by typing `skypeforlinux` in the terminal or finding it in your applications menu.

Installing Skype via Snap

Snap is another easy-to-use package management system that can be used to install Skype:
  1. **Install Snap**: If not already installed, add Snap support by executing:
```bash sudo zypper install snapd sudo systemctl enable --now snapd sudo systemctl start snapd ```
  1. **Install Skype**: With Snap installed, execute:
```bash sudo snap install skype --classic ```

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use Skype on older versions of openSUSE?

Yes, but it's recommended to use the latest version of openSUSE for better compatibility and security.

2. Is Skype free on openSUSE?

Yes, Skype offers free services like voice and video calls. However, some features like calling landlines or sending SMS are paid.

3. How do I update Skype on openSUSE?

If installed via RPM, use `sudo zypper update skypeforlinux` to update. For Snap, execute `sudo snap refresh skype`.

4. What should I do if Skype crashes frequently?

Ensure your system is updated, and try reinstalling Skype. Check for any conflicting applications running in the background.

5. Can I use Skype for Business on openSUSE?

Skype for Business is primarily designed for Windows and macOS. However, using web versions or alternatives like Microsoft Teams might be viable options.
